Cercis canadensis 'MN Strain' (Redbud)
This handsome tree bears small pink flowers in spring before leaves appear, later brown fruit pods form. Grown from seed collected at the Minnesota Landscape Arboretum. Does well in sun and part shade. Selected for hardiness by the University of Minnesota and introduced in1992. Fall foliage: Brilliant yellow.
